Why Drain Opening Matters in Monteagle’s Unique Environment

Monteagle, Tennessee sits atop the Cumberland Plateau, where heavy seasonal rains, rich clay soils, and older sewer laterals all combine to make blockages more common than in many other towns. When sink, tub, or floor drains slow to a trickle, the risk of wastewater backups grows quickly. HEP company understands that homeowners and businesses here cannot ignore a clog for long; the steep grades of many properties mean that a partial obstruction can turn into an overflow within hours. Proactive plumbing drain opening in Monteagle is not merely a convenience—it is essential for protecting interiors, landscaping, and groundwater alike.

Mechanical Drain Snaking

For localized clogs such as hair buildup in bathroom drains, the technician selects a sectional or continuous cable machine sized for the pipe diameter. Cutting heads range from retrieving heads for keyed-in jewelry to serrated blades for stubborn soap/scale rings. Proper torque and feed speed protect fragile, older drain walls common in Monteagle’s 1960s cottages.

Hydro Jetting for Main Line Restoration

When camera feeds reveal grease mats, sludge, or root intrusions in the main sewer lateral, HEP company’s high-pressure hydro jetting restores the full internal diameter. Water volume and PSI are calibrated to:

  • 1½" – 2" kitchen lines: 1,500–2,000 PSI
  • 3" – 4" branch drains: 2,500–3,000 PSI
  • 4" – 6" clay or cast-iron mains: 3,500 PSI with a rotating root-cutting nozzle

Advanced nozzles propel themselves forward then flush debris backward, pulling roots and grit toward the external clean-out rather than into the municipal main.

Bio-Enzymatic Treatment Post-Jetting

HEP encourages a final bio-enzymatic application. Live cultures digest leftover organic film without harming the Plateau’s sensitive groundwater system. Unlike harsh acids, these microbes continue working for weeks, offering a protective layer against rapid re-clogging.

The Science Behind Persistent Monteagle Clogs

Drain obstructions are rarely random. Understanding the underlying chemistry and physics helps property owners appreciate why professional service makes a difference.

Grease Polymers and Cold-Water Solidification

Many Monteagle cabins feature large stone fireplaces. During winter, residents pour bacon grease down drains thinking the extra hot water chase will wash it away. Once the effluent hits cold vent stacks or outdoor pipe runs, triglyceride molecules crystallize, trapping lint and coffee grounds.

Biofilm and Iron Oxidation

Iron-laden water from some private wells reacts with air in vent stacks, forming rusty flakes. Biofilm bacteria bind these flakes into a rough surface, narrowing pipe diameter. Left unaddressed, the pipe can corrode entirely.

Capillary Root Invasion

Hardwood trees on the Plateau send feeder roots toward condensation around sewer joints. Roots exploit hairline cracks, then swell with water absorption, creating a physical dam. Hydro jetting cuts and flushes them, but targeted herbicidal foam may be recommended where repeat invasion is likely.

Signs Your Monteagle Property Needs HEP’s Drain Opening Service

Audible and Visual Indicators

  • Gurgling sounds in distant fixtures when a toilet flushes
  • Water pooling around basement floor drains after storms
  • Bubbles rising through the toilet bowl while running a sink
  • Slow bathtub drainage accompanied by a mildew odor

Seasonal Symptom Patterns

Spring thaw often dislodges roof debris into gutters, sending sediment into downspout drains. Autumn leaf drop can fill yard drains, forcing surface water toward foundations. HEP company maps these seasonal risk windows into maintenance schedules.

Preventive Maintenance Strategies Recommended by HEP

Routine attention is the cheapest insurance against disruptive drain emergencies.

Monthly Practices

  • Run hot water with a dash of eco-friendly dish soap down kitchen drains after greasy meals
  • Brush hair from shower stoppers rather than relying on water flow to move it
  • Verify that washing machine lint traps are intact and cleaned

Seasonal Habits

  • Early spring: Flush gutter downspouts with a garden hose to confirm clear yard drains
  • Mid-summer: Inspect tree root growth near sewer laterals; consider protective root barriers
  • Late fall: Clear leaves from patio drains before freezing temperatures arrive

Annual Professional Services

  • Schedule a camera inspection to establish a visual record of pipe health
  • Hydro jet restaurant or commercial kitchen lines during off-peak hours
  • Test gravity sewer grades to confirm proper pitch after earth tremors common on the Plateau

Common Myths About Drain Opening in Monteagle

“Store-Bought Chemicals Are Faster Than a Plumber”

Corrosive gels might promise instant results, but they rarely dissolve roots or mineral scale. They can also pit cast-iron pipes, leading to costly lining or replacement. Mechanical clearing plus jetting from HEP removes obstructions physically, leaving nothing behind to eat away at pipe walls.

“If One Fixture Drains Fine, the Line Is Clear”

Many Monteagle homes have branch lines tied into the main at different elevations. A kitchen sink may flow normally while a basement shower clogs, indicating a partial obstruction downstream. Overlooking early signs worsens eventual backups.

“Root Problems Only Affect Old Clay Pipes”

PVC and ABS joints can still shift under soil movement, allowing root hairs to sneak into the gasket space. Age is less critical than joint integrity, which is why inspection cameras remain vital.

Advanced Drain Rehabilitation After Opening

If inspection reveals pipe damage beyond simple blockage, HEP offers trenchless options to Monteagle property owners.

Cured-In-Place Pipe (CIPP) Spot Repair

Small breaches up to 3 feet long are lined internally with an epoxy-saturated felt tube. No excavation is needed; the liner bonds to the host pipe, sealing cracks and preventing future root intrusion.

Full-Length Lateral Lining

For more significant deterioration, a seamless epoxy liner is inverted through the entire lateral to the main tap. This process restores flow capacity, improves hydraulic efficiency, and adds decades of service life without digging through landscaped yards.

Pipe Bursting for Collapsed Lines

If a line has collapsed entirely, pipe bursting replaces it by pulling a new HDPE pipe through the old path while simultaneously fracturing the failed pipe outward. Only two access pits are required, preserving trees and driveways.
